Janet Spencer Wins REIV Buyer’s Agent of the Year 2013

Janet Spencer Wins REIV Buyer’s Agent of the Year 2013 The Real Estate Institute of Victoria (REIV) Awards for Excellence 2013 were held at Crown Palladium on Thursday 17 October 2013 and Janet Spencer of BuyerSolutions.com.au in Kew received the ‘Buyer’s Agent of the Year’ Award for the second year in a row. Falling Australian Dollar Wakes Up Overseas Buyers

Falling Australian Dollar Wakes Up Overseas Buyers The Australian Dollar has fallen considerably from recent highs.
